If you are thinking about
becoming your own boss, and the business model of franchising is
intriguing to you, where do you start your search for that stellar, knock your socks off, franchise?

There are a few different routes to start your franchise search at. You can:
1. Go to a bookstore, and purchase a few Entrepreneur Magazines that have information on franchises and business opportunities.
2.
Go to the library with a notebook, and copy down some information from
those magazines ,and maybe even look at a few books about franchising.
3. Look for a franchise consultant/broker who can help you narrow things down, significantly.
4. Ask your Uncles, Aunts, 4th Cousins, co-workers etc. what franchises are “hot”
